Republic Steel will invest $85.2 million in an electric arc furnace (EAF) and associated equipment at its steelmaking facility in Lorain, Ohio, to meet growing customer demand for the company’s SBQ steel. The new furnace is expected to increase the company’s steel production by 1 million tons annually and will account for Lorain’s first significant growth in steelmaking in the 21st century. It will also enable production of bloom cast for the production of SBQ bar and the production of seamless tube rounds. Construction of the EAF is scheduled to begin in 2012 and be complete in mid-2013.

It is estimated that the project will bring 449 new jobs and more than $1 billion dollars in annual economic activity to Ohio. The existing 489 jobs at the Lorain facility will be retained. The location was chosen for its proximity to customers and its skilled workforce.
